Snap Inc. is a technology company founded in 2011 by Evan Spiegel and Bobby Murphy, who own 95% of voting shares. It develops and maintains Snapchat, Spectacles, Bitmoji, and other products and services, and went public in 2017.

Bobby Murphy is an American Internet entrepreneur and software engineer who co-founded Snapchat with Evan Spiegel and Reggie Brown while they were students at Stanford University. He is the CTO of Snap Inc. and one of the world's youngest billionaires.
